New Visual Identity for Five by DixonBaxi

Well, when DixonBaxi was tasked with redesigning the visual identity of five, they didn’t hold back. Some of the biggest studios and artists were chosen to create the channel’s new branding: Buck, Partizan, Cassiano Prado, Aardman Animations, Chris Cairns, Flynn and Rokkit, Mate Steinforth, and more.

The result is a new vision for the channel — younger, more creative, and more colorful:
